How Much To Hire A Mini Digger

When it comes to construction projects, landscaping, or any task that requires excavation or moving large amounts of soil, hiring a mini digger can be a cost-effective and efficient solution. A mini digger, also known as a compact excavator, is a versatile piece of machinery that is designed to perform a wide range of tasks in tight and confined spaces.

The cost of hiring a mini digger can vary depending on several factors, such as the duration of the hire, the size and model of the digger, and the additional attachments or accessories required. Understanding how much it costs to hire a mini digger is essential for budgeting and planning purposes.

Key Principles

When considering how much it costs to hire a mini digger, several key principles come into play:

  1. Duration of Hire: The longer the duration of the hire, the higher the overall cost is likely to be. Most hire companies offer daily, weekly, or monthly rates, with discounts available for longer hire periods.
  2. Size and Model: Mini diggers come in various sizes and models, each with different capabilities and specifications. The cost of hiring will depend on the size and model chosen, as larger or more advanced machines may command higher rental prices.
  3. Attachments and Accessories: Mini diggers can be equipped with a range of attachments and accessories, such as buckets, breakers, augers, or rippers. The cost of hiring these additional tools will be added to the base rental price.
  4. Transportation: If the hire company is responsible for delivering and collecting the mini digger, transportation costs may be included in the overall price. However, if the hirer needs to arrange transportation, additional fees may apply.
  5. Insurance and Maintenance: It is essential to consider insurance and maintenance costs when hiring a mini digger. Some hire companies may include insurance coverage and regular maintenance in the rental price, while others may charge separately for these services.

Components

A typical mini digger hire package includes:

  1. The mini digger itself, which is the main component of the package.
  2. A standard bucket attachment for general excavation and earthmoving tasks.
  3. Basic operating instructions and safety guidelines.
  4. Optional extras, such as additional attachments, accessories, or specialized buckets, which may incur additional costs.
  5. Delivery and collection service, if provided by the hire company.
  6. Insurance coverage and maintenance, depending on the hire company’s policies.

It is important to note that the components included in a mini digger hire package may vary between hire companies, and it is advisable to clarify the inclusions and exclusions before finalizing any agreement.
